package option
import (
"fmt"
"strconv"
"strings"
)
// MonitorAggregationLevel represents a level of aggregation for monitor events
// from the datapath. Low values represent no aggregation, that is, to increase
// the number of events emitted from the datapath; Higher values represent more
// aggregation, to minimize the number of events emitted from the datapath.
//
// The MonitorAggregationLevel does not affect the Debug option in the daemon
// or endpoint, so debug notifications will continue uninhibited by this
// setting.
type MonitorAggregationLevel OptionSetting
const (
// MonitorAggregationLevelNone represents no aggregation in the
// datapath; all packets will be monitored.
MonitorAggregationLevelNone OptionSetting = 0
// MonitorAggregationLevelLow represents aggregation of monitor events
// to emit a maximum of one trace event per packet. Trace events when
// packets are received are disabled.
MonitorAggregationLevelLowest OptionSetting = 1
// MonitorAggregationLevelLow is the same as
// MonitorAggregationLevelLowest, but may aggregate additional traffic
// in future.
MonitorAggregationLevelLow OptionSetting = 2
// MonitorAggregationLevelMedium represents aggregation of monitor
// events to only emit notifications periodically for each connection
// unless there is new information (eg, a TCP connection is closed).
MonitorAggregationLevelMedium OptionSetting = 3
// MonitorAggregationLevelMax is the maximum level of aggregation
// currently supported.
MonitorAggregationLevelMax OptionSetting = 4
)
// monitorAggregationOption maps a user-specified string to a monitor
// aggregation level.
var monitorAggregationOption = map[string]OptionSetting{
"": MonitorAggregationLevelNone,
"none": MonitorAggregationLevelNone,
"disabled": MonitorAggregationLevelNone,
"lowest": MonitorAggregationLevelLowest,
"low": MonitorAggregationLevelLow,
"medium": MonitorAggregationLevelMedium,
"max": MonitorAggregationLevelMax,
"maximum": MonitorAggregationLevelMax,
}
func init() {
for i := MonitorAggregationLevelNone; i <= MonitorAggregationLevelMax; i++ {
number := strconv.Itoa(int(i))
monitorAggregationOption[number] = OptionSetting(i)
}
}
// monitorAggregationFormat maps an aggregation level to a formatted string.
var monitorAggregationFormat = map[OptionSetting]string{
MonitorAggregationLevelNone: "None",
MonitorAggregationLevelLowest: "Lowest",
MonitorAggregationLevelLow: "Low",
MonitorAggregationLevelMedium: "Medium",
MonitorAggregationLevelMax: "Max",
}
// VerifyMonitorAggregationLevel validates the specified key/value for a
// monitor aggregation level.
func VerifyMonitorAggregationLevel(key, value string) error {
_, err := ParseMonitorAggregationLevel(value)
return err
}
// ParseMonitorAggregationLevel turns a string into a monitor aggregation
// level. The string may contain an integer value or a string representation of
// a particular monitor aggregation level.
func ParseMonitorAggregationLevel(value string) (OptionSetting, error) {
// First, attempt the string representation.
if level, ok := monitorAggregationOption[strings.ToLower(value)]; ok {
return level, nil
}
// If it's not a valid string option, attempt to parse an integer.
valueParsed, err := strconv.Atoi(value)
if err != nil {
err = fmt.Errorf("invalid monitor aggregation level %q", value)
return MonitorAggregationLevelNone, err
}
parsed := OptionSetting(valueParsed)
if parsed < MonitorAggregationLevelNone || parsed > MonitorAggregationLevelMax {
err = fmt.Errorf("monitor aggregation level must be between %d and %d",
MonitorAggregationLevelNone, MonitorAggregationLevelMax)
return MonitorAggregationLevelNone, err
}
return parsed, nil
}
// FormatMonitorAggregationLevel maps a MonitorAggregationLevel to a string.
func FormatMonitorAggregationLevel(level OptionSetting) string {
return monitorAggregationFormat[level]
}
